Subject: Marletta Unit Sale — Status

Exec team,

The sale of the Marletta coatings unit to Brevane Holdings closes Friday. Diligence is done; escrow terms agreed. Darien Volk, our incoming director, owns transition from Monday. Staff comms go out after signing, not before. Retention offers limited to six named engineers. Keep all counterparty details off shared drives. Full rationale and next steps are set out below.

management briefing: The renewal with Zoraelax Group closes at $10 million a year, 15 percent below the last contract. Project Ralael slips by six weeks because of the audit delay.

# ShadeCheck Environments

ShadeCheck runs the color-contrast accessibility audit against three environments: dev, staging, and prod-mirror. Dev rebuilds on every merge; staging refreshes nightly with the latest design tokens from the Palettia team. Prod-mirror is read-only and used solely for release sign-off. Audit thresholds follow WCAG-style ratios and are identical across environments, though sampling depth differs. For the upcoming release, staging is the environment of record, and its current configuration values are shown below.

settings of bawif-fawif:
ralix:
  log_level: warn
  metrics_host: metrics.ralix.tolvaqsys.internal
  pool_size: 32

Handover Note — Seed Sample Transfer

Tomas, the certified seed samples for the Windmere trial plot are packed and ready at the dispatch desk. Twelve labelled pouches of the Aurilex barley line, sealed in the insulated carrier with desiccant packs checked this morning. They must stay below twenty degrees and reach the plot station before Friday's sowing window. Chain-of-custody sheet is attached to the carrier handle; every transfer must be signed. The confidential hand-over instruction for the courier appears directly below.

handover note for yagef-bagep: the drudor pelius courier leaves the kasdor zorvan norir ledger at gate 8016 under passcode 755406

Health checks on the Grelling tier behind the Pondera load balancer are failing since Tuesday. Root cause: the probe credential expired; nodes return 401 and get drained. Not a capacity issue. Contractor task: update the probe config on all four nodes, restart the agent, confirm targets go healthy. Replacement credential for the internal probe endpoint is below.

API key for tagug-tajef: vxb4-R1fo